Andrew Morton has already merged this patch.

Randy Dunlap: avoid warnings on sparc64

Signed-off-by: Randy Dunlap <[EMAIL PROTECTED]>
Signed-off-by: Ed L. Cashin <[EMAIL PROTECTED]>

diff -uprN a/drivers/block/aoe/aoeblk.c b/drivers/block/aoe/aoeblk.c
--- a/drivers/block/aoe/aoeblk.c        2005-03-07 17:37:14.000000000 -0500
+++ b/drivers/block/aoe/aoeblk.c        2005-03-10 12:20:00.000000000 -0500
@@ -28,7 +28,8 @@ static ssize_t aoedisk_show_mac(struct g
 {
        struct aoedev *d = disk->private_data;
 
-       return snprintf(page, PAGE_SIZE, "%012llx\n", mac_addr(d->addr));
+       return snprintf(page, PAGE_SIZE, "%012llx\n",
+                       (unsigned long long)mac_addr(d->addr));
 }
 static ssize_t aoedisk_show_netif(struct gendisk * disk, char *page)
 {
@@ -241,7 +242,8 @@ aoeblk_gdalloc(void *vp)
        aoedisk_add_sysfs(d);
        
        printk(KERN_INFO "aoe: %012llx e%lu.%lu v%04x has %llu "
-               "sectors\n", mac_addr(d->addr), d->aoemajor, d->aoeminor,
+               "sectors\n", (unsigned long long)mac_addr(d->addr),
+               d->aoemajor, d->aoeminor,
                d->fw_ver, (long long)d->ssize);
 }
